Varicose Vein Treatment Options
At the very least, varicose veins have an unpleasant appearance. However, they can also lead to other serious consequences such as painful, swollen legs. Over half of all Americans have some form of vein disease. Aging is probably the biggest offender in terms of risk factors for the development of varicose veins.
Is it an overgeneralization to say that we all want to look younger and healthier? Certainly, many of us do. With modern advances in technology, there are multiple treatment options available for varicose veins. Sclerotherapy, endovenous laser treatment and microphlebectomy are but a few.
